An opinion piece in The Guardian argues that perceived impunity for corruption, exemplified by Donald Trump’s consideration of a $230 million compensation claim against the U.S. government, could breed public cynicism and complacency. The author warns that such cynicism may undergird autocratic tendencies and potentially weaken institutional trust, raising questions about long-term market stability.

The Guardian’s Judith Levine examines the corrosive effect of impunity, citing Donald Trump’s reported adherence to mentor Roy Cohn’s principle of never admitting wrongdoing or apologizing. In October, while considering renewed claims for $230 million in compensation for federal investigations against him, Trump acknowledged the awkwardness of the situation. “It sort of looks bad, I’m suing myself, right?” he said, according to the piece. The author contends that such behavior fosters popular cynicism, which in turn can undermine democratic norms and enable autocratic governance. The article frames this dynamic as a cycle: impunity breeds cynicism, cynicism breeds complacency, and complacency deepens acceptance of unchecked power. Key takeaways from the analysis suggest that institutional erosion driven by perceived corruption may have indirect but material effects on financial markets. Investor confidence often relies on predictable rule of law, transparent governance, and accountability mechanisms. When these weaken, market participants may become desensitized to risk — a state of complacency that the author warns can allow systemic vulnerabilities to build. The specific $230 million claim, while not large by U.S. government standards, symbolizes a broader pattern of self-dealing that could erode trust in fiscal policy and legal protections. Historical examples elsewhere have shown that widespread cynicism toward political systems can correlate with reduced foreign direct investment and increased capital flight. From an investment perspective, prolonged uncertainty around governance integrity could influence portfolio allocation decisions. While short-term markets may appear resilient, the potential for sudden shifts in regulatory or legal environments might warrant increased attention to political risk factors. Investors could consider diversifying across jurisdictions with stronger institutional safeguards or monitoring governance indices. The Guardian piece does not provide specific market data, but its underlying thesis — that unpunished corruption risks normalizing poor governance — aligns with broader concerns about the stability of democratic systems that underpin many developed markets. As always, such analyses should be weighed alongside other macroeconomic indicators, and no specific trading action is implied.
